13 module rt.typeinfo.ti_Adouble; | |
14 | |
15 private import rt.typeinfo.ti_double; | |
16 | |
17 // double[] | |
18 | |
19 class TypeInfo_Ad : TypeInfo | |
20 { | |
21 override string toString() { return "double[]"; } | |
22 | |
23 override hash_t getHash(in void* p) | |
24 { double[] s = *cast(double[]*)p; | |
25 size_t len = s.length; | |
26 auto str = s.ptr; | |
27 hash_t hash = 0; | |
28 | |
29 while (len) | |
30 { | |
31 hash *= 9; | |
32 hash += (cast(uint *)str)[0]; | |
33 hash += (cast(uint *)str)[1]; | |
34 str++; | |
35 len--; | |
36 } | |
37 | |
38 return hash; | |
39 } | |
40 | |
41 override equals_t equals(in void* p1, in void* p2) | |
42 { | |
43 double[] s1 = *cast(double[]*)p1; | |
44 double[] s2 = *cast(double[]*)p2; | |
45 size_t len = s1.length; | |
46 | |
47 if (len != s2.length) | |
48 return 0; | |
49 for (size_t u = 0; u < len; u++) | |
50 { | |
51 if (!TypeInfo_d._equals(s1[u], s2[u])) | |
52 return false; | |
53 } | |
54 return true; | |
55 } | |
56 | |
57 override int compare(in void* p1, in void* p2) | |
58 { | |
59 double[] s1 = *cast(double[]*)p1; | |
60 double[] s2 = *cast(double[]*)p2; | |
61 size_t len = s1.length; | |
62 | |
63 if (s2.length < len) | |
64 len = s2.length; | |
65 for (size_t u = 0; u < len; u++) | |
66 { | |
67 int c = TypeInfo_d._compare(s1[u], s2[u]); | |
68 if (c) | |
69 return c; | |
70 } | |
71 if (s1.length < s2.length) | |
72 return -1; | |
73 else if (s1.length > s2.length) | |
74 return 1; | |
75 return 0; | |
76 } | |
77 | |
78 override size_t tsize() | |
79 { | |
80 return (double[]).sizeof; | |
81 } | |
82 | |
83 override uint flags() | |
84 { | |
85 return 1; | |
86 } | |
87 | |
88 override TypeInfo next() | |
89 { | |
90 return typeid(double); | |
91 } | |
92 } | |
93 | |
94 // idouble[] | |
95 | |
96 class TypeInfo_Ap : TypeInfo_Ad | |
97 { | |
98 override string toString() { return "idouble[]"; } | |
99 | |
100 override TypeInfo next() | |
101 { | |
102 return typeid(idouble); | |
103 } | |
104 } |
